]> git.openstreetmap.org Git - chef.git/commitdiff
nominatim: use server url when server is not in production
authorSarah Hoffmann <lonvia@denofr.de>
Fri, 23 Sep 2016 10:26:18 +0000 (12:26 +0200)
committerSarah Hoffmann <lonvia@denofr.de>
Fri, 23 Sep 2016 10:26:18 +0000 (12:26 +0200)
cookbooks/nominatim/recipes/default.rb
cookbooks/nominatim/templates/default/settings.erb

index f09918e85cf483bfef9b6ff316d7f4f32929b978..b3f3b1a47cba9306f902212f5e1e889a3deecc5b 100644 (file)
@@ -194,7 +194,8 @@ template "#{build_directory}/settings/local.php" do
   owner "nominatim"
   group "nominatim"
   mode 0o664
-  variables :dbname => node[:nominatim][:dbname],
+  variables :base_url => node[:nominatim][:state] == "off" ? node[:fdqn] : "nominatim.openstreetmap.org",
+            :dbname => node[:nominatim][:dbname],
             :flatnode_file => node[:nominatim][:flatnode_file],
             :log_file => "#{node[:nominatim][:logdir]}/query.log"
 end
index 0e335c2e4cf123dc8f4c7aa69e46c3d4a0836201..afab0803e580ae5ca79997df30dade9ce942e896 100644 (file)
@@ -3,9 +3,9 @@
 
 @define('CONST_Database_DSN', 'pgsql://@/<%= @dbname %>');
 if (isset($_SERVER['HTTPS']) && !empty($_SERVER['HTTPS']))
-    @define('CONST_Website_BaseURL', 'https://nominatim.openstreetmap.org/');
+    @define('CONST_Website_BaseURL', 'https://<%= @base_url %>/');
 else
-    @define('CONST_Website_BaseURL', 'http://nominatim.openstreetmap.org/');
+    @define('CONST_Website_BaseURL', 'http://<%= @base_url %>/');
 
 <% if @flatnode_file -%>
 @define('CONST_Osm2pgsql_Flatnode_File', '<%= @flatnode_file %>');